About 10 St Martins Close
10 St Martins Close is a two-bedroom detached house in Cromer (NR27 0BN). It has a recorded floor area of 59 m² (around 635 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1967-1975 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(March 2023) shows a D (score 67),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. Earlier certificates rated it C (June 2010); the latest reading is one band lower. Between certificates, wall efficiency dropped from Good to Average and window efficiency dropped from Good to Average.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 85), a 2-band jump.
Sold September 2019 for £220,000.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. 2 planning records sit against the property, 1 approved, 1 refused. Past consents include an extension and a loft conversion,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Across 1997–2019, sale prices on this property compounded at 6.1%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£281,000 is 27.7% above the 2019 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£346/sq ft) was about 44.3% above the typical sold price in the postcode. At 59 m² it's 29.4%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(84 m² median across 8 EPCs).
